Utah FORGE Project 3-2417: Meteorological Data During 2023 Completion/Circulation
Abstract
This preliminary data archive includes meteorological data recorded at the Utah FORGE facility over the period of time including the completion/cementing of well 78-16B and the initial 2023 circulation test, largely occurring in June/July/August of 2023. This information may prove useful for understanding seismic and other instrumentation responses during these activities. The meteorological station was installed June 23rd, 2023 during drilling; the circulation test occurred in mid July of 2023 (July 4-19). The included files span this period. All sensors were installed at the 16 pad and hence reflect weather state at the site. This dataset was acquired by the FOGMORE R&D project (Fiber Optic MOnitoring for Reservoir Evolution), Utah FORGE R&D Project 3-2417.
